Output e5430878fa4d697cc1330d2680a961296ae29a3045919da9ef9b14d97c037719:6

value
2116978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945467a625e817baa7573160bbf883633fe5244d OP_EQUAL
address
3FDK3VHRuP9rvnKULjmobrWzRUM2RsSKTU
transaction
e5430878fa4d697cc1330d2680a961296ae29a3045919da9ef9b14d97c037719
spent
true